Standardization of DMX/RDM Over Ethernet

Modern projects rely heavily on networking protocols like Art-Net and sACN. These systems run thousands of universes over standard fiber-optic lines, replacing traditional copper wiring with high-speed digital arrays.

Energy Efficiency & Eco-Compliance

Green building standards demand lower power usage. Modern creative lighting systems balance bright, dynamic output with low standby power draw. They feature high power-factor drivers and thermal management to minimize overall power usage.

Kinetic Winch Control Mechanics

Our winches feature quiet stepper motors and dual-stage braking systems, enabling smooth movement up to 1.5 meters per second. Micro-step drivers keep position accuracy within 1mm, preventing wobble or lag in complex formations.

Thermal Design & Heat Dissipation

Using forged aluminum heatsinks and temperature-controlled silent fans, we keep LED junction temperatures below 75°C. This prevents thermal degradation and maintains color accuracy across long operating periods.

Signal Transmission & Protection

Onboard micro-controllers support high refresh rates (over 3840Hz), avoiding flicker on video broadcasts. Built-in optoelectronic isolation protects control networks against voltage surges and static discharge.

Safety Factor Standards

All suspended winches are engineered with a safety factor of 10:1. They include mechanical limiters to prevent cable over-extension and lock automatically if power is cut.

What payload values can your DMX kinetic winches handle?

Our standard kinetic winches support payloads from 1.5kg to 5kg, depending on the model and lift speed. For custom installations, we can build heavy-duty winches that handle up to 10kg payloads with reliable vertical movement.

How do you sync kinetic winches with third-party software?

Our systems run on standard DMX512 protocol configurations and connect easily via Art-Net nodes. You can sync and map them using software like Madrix, Resolume, or grandMA consoles.

What measures prevent signal latency on large LED setups?

To prevent signal latency, we use high-speed transceivers and advise splitting control runs into separate universes using dedicated Art-Net splitters. This design keeps data flow consistent and maintains smooth playback.
